Sounds On Grief is a multidisciplinary project that offers a fresh lens on the processes and reflections of grief. What you’ll hear, read, and see across this project is a collection of sounds, poems, and visuals from 21 individuals around the world that captures the complex, inexplicable nature of grief—the longing, vulnerability, confusion, anger, hope, fragility, emptiness, and expansiveness that develop in the space of losing the ones we hold most dear.

With care and deep gratitude, we share these personal reflections on grief from those who responded to our open call in January 2024. Their words and voices shape this project, and we’re moved by their openness in sharing them.
